#F17C4D Hex Color Code

#F17C4D

The Hexadecimal Color #F17C4D is a contrast shade of Coral. #F17C4D RGB value is rgb(241, 124, 77). RGB Color Model of #F17C4D consists of 94% red, 48% green and 30% blue. HSL color Mode of #F17C4D has 17°(degrees) Hue, 85% Saturation and 62% Lightness. #F17C4D color has an wavelength of 609.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#F17C4D is #FF9966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#F17C4D is #E75. The Closest Color to #F17C4D is #FF7F50. Official Name of #F17C4D Hex Code is Burnt Sienna.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#F17C4D is 0 Cyan 49 Magenta 68 Yellow 5 Black and #F17C4D CMY is 0, 49, 68.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#F17C4D is hsl(17,85,62,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(17, 68, 95).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#F17C4D is 44.83, 33.66, 11.16.
Hex8 Value of #F17C4D is #F17C4DFF. Decimal Value of #F17C4D is 15825997 and Octal Value of #F17C4D is 74276115. Binary Value of #F17C4D is 11110001, 1111100, 1001101 and Android of #F17C4D is 4294016077 / 0xfff17c4d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#F17C4D is 0.5, 0.375, 0.375 and YIQ Color Space of #F17C4D is 153.625, 84.8214, 10.1191.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#F17C4D is 45.5, 25.66, 11.57.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#F17C4D is 64.69, 41.4, 45.53.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#F17C4D is 64.69, 92.2, 42.96.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#F17C4D is 64.69, 61.54, 47.72. Hunter Lab variable of #F17C4D is 58.02, 36.4, 29.21.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#F17C4D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
